To delete your Craigslist history, you’ll need to clear your cookies and cache. To do this in Chrome, open up the Settings menu and select “Show advanced settings.” Under the “Privacy” section, click on “Clear browsing data.” From there, select the “Cookies and other site and plug-in data” and “Cache” options and click on “Clear data.
